Ah I guess if you look at Australians as how they identify their ancestry, then it’s about 89% English/Australian/Irish/Scottish. But it’s also very different depending on what city you’re in verses being in a rural area.

Edit: you should also note that australia has a high proportion of overseas born people. We are very diverse. Half the population of Australia were either born overseas or has one parent that was born overseas.
